Welcome to the Dubai Hospital Radiology Department’s home page for patient education.
Patient education is more important today than ever before. In fact it is the fundamental aspect of patient care, as it guides patients to gain their cooperation and make the radiology procedure as smooth as possible.
Generally, a patient arrives at the radiology department without any

(or with only basic) information about x-ray examinations.
This site gives a detailed description of preparations, purposes, approximate procedural durations, equipment used and follow up care necessary when the procedure is completed.

Developmental Dysplasia of the Hip (DDH)

 

DDH is a congenital dislocation or subluxation of the hip joint found in children. It occurs in 1 out of 1000 births. The hip joint is a ball and socket joint, constant of femoral head (the ball) and the acetabululum (the socket).
